Make a theoretical system actual by providing stable voltages with this LDO LM2940T-8.0 linear regulator from Texas Instruments. Its typical dropout voltage at current is 0.11@100mA|0.5@1A V. This voltage regulation device's single output can produce a current up to 1(Min) A. It only needs a voltage of at least 9.4 V while not exceeding 26 V to effectively power your circuit. With a fixed output that has a voltage of 8 V, this is power management at its best. To produce a constant current at your output, supply your circuit with a load regulation of 80mV and line regulation of 80mV. In order to ensure parts aren't damaged by bulk packaging, this product comes in tube packaging to add a little more protection by storing the loose parts in an outer tube. The maximum dropout voltage is 0.8@1A|0.15@100mA V. This voltage regulation device has a minimum operating temperature of -40 °C and a maximum of 125 °C. Its polarity is positive.
